Job Advert
You will provide podiatric care in a variety of settings where you will be either directly or indirectly supervised whilst remaining part of a wider team. You will provide a high level of care both palliative and corrective as part of an agreed care plan whilst liaising with or referring to other Health Care Professionals (HCPC’s) or Agencies as appropriate. You will plan and organise your own workload to ensure effective caseload management of a diverse range of patients. You will make a full assessment and diagnoses of patients’ podiatric conditions in order to establish a treatment/ management plan and assess patient’s associated medical conditions. You should have the ability to work with a diverse group of patients incorporating all age groups with complex medical needs e.g. Learning Disabilities, Diabetes, vascular disease, Rheumatoid Arthritis. It is essential that you have a Degree/Diploma in Podiatry and that you are currently registered with the HCPC. The shift pattern for this post is various hours.
